كيفية اختيار بندا على الشاشه


  Share  
|


أزرار تسمح للمستخدم أن ينقر ويجعل عمل تحدث. نوع مختلف من واجهة المستخدم عنصر ، ومع ذلك ، تتيح للمستعمل اختر بندا على الشاشه.

والفارق بينهما هو أن ينقر مستخدم لبالاختيار ، والفيلم كليب ان يغير المظهر. ولكن اي شيء آخر يحدث. وبهذه الطريقة ، يمكن للمستعمل ان يجعل لها او تغيير الاختيارات. وبعد ذلك ، يستطيع المستخدم النقر فوق زر آخر او تأدية عمل آخر.

سنقوم استخدام الخيارات بوصفها خطوة اولى على طريق تعلم كيفية جر واسقاط لقطات الفيلم ، والهدف من هذا البرنامج التعليمي.

زر داخل الفيلم طريقة كليب

فيلم كليب لا يمكن ببساطة الرد على ماوس انقر. وخلافا زر ، وانها لا يمكن ان تستخدم على (الافراج) او عن (الصحافة) المعالج.

بحيث يكون لديك العويصه. قمت بوضع زر داخل فيلم كليب. الزر يمكنهم التعامل مع نقرات الماوس ، طالما انه كبير بما يكفي لتغطية كامل السينما كليب.

انتقل الى اختيارها هذا الفيلم كليب ، لذا سنعرض لها لجعل هذا الفيلم الى multiframe كليب. الأولى الاطار تتضمن زر اسمه من زر. هذا الزر له النصي التالية :

  على (الافراج) (this.gotoandstop (2) ؛) 

بالاشاره الى هذا ، والزر موجود في الاشارة الى ان الفيلم كليب ومن الدخول في الاطار 2 من الفيلم كليب يحتوي على زر اسمه مماثلة على زر. والفرق هو ان على الزر هو قليلا اكثر اشراقا ، مشيرا الى ان الفيلم كليب تم اختيارها. السكريبت على هذا الفيلم كليب هو مماثل :

  على (الافراج) (this.gotoandstop (1) ؛) 

كما انك قد تخمين ، بالنقر على الزر على الإطار 2 ، الفيلم كليب يذهب الى الاطار 1 ، من حيث الاصل ويقع على زر. بالنقر على أزرار في فيلم كليب مرارا وتكرارا ، فيلم كليب يذهب جيءه وذهابا بين الاطر 1 و 2.

الشيء الوحيد الذي غادر هو الى مكان محطة () ؛ القيادة على الاطار الاول للفيلم كليب.

طريقة hittest

يمكنك كشف ماوس انقر في فيلم كليب بدون زر. بيد ان هذه الطريقة هي اصعب قليلا. بعد أنت تعلم انها ، رغم ذلك ، فهو أنظف بكثير الحل.

لكشف ماوس انقر على السينما كليب بدون زر ، واستخدام onclipevent (mousedown) او onclipevent (mouseup (فيلم كليب عمال. على سبيل المثال ، يمكنك وضع ما يلي النص على فيلم كليب :

  Onclipevent (mouseup) (this.gotoandstop (2) ؛) 

اثنين الاطر في فيلم كليب ، مع كل داءره ذات لون مختلف. محطة () ؛ القيادة هي على اول اطار من الفيلم كليب.

عندما تحاول هذا الفيلم ، سترى الحق بعيدا عن السبب onclipevent (mouseup (المعالج يختلف عن المعنى (الافراج) المعالج تستخدم على الازرار. اذا نقرت على واحد الفيلم كليب ، فكلاهما رد.

وذلك لان جميع الفيلم لقطات للحصول على mouseup الحدث ارسل اليهم. انها ليست قاصره على مجرد فيلم كليب تحت المؤشر.

تحديد قصاصة الفيلم الذي كان ينقر

وثمة طريقة لتحديد كليب الفيلم الذي تم النقر فوقه. فان hittest اختبار اداء ماوس الموقع مع فيلم كليب لمعرفة ما اذا كان المكان داخل الفيلم كليب. بذلك ، عن طريق تعديل النصي ، لا يسعنا الا ان ترسل الصحيح فيلم كليب لدورته الثانية الاطار.

  Onclipevent (mouseup) (اذا (this.hittest (_root._xmouse ، _root._ymouse)) (this.gotoandstop (2) ؛)) 

فان hittest مهمة يمكن ان تعمل مجموعة متنوعة من الطرق المختلفة. وفي هذه الحاله ، ومن تغذي سين وصاد قيم الماوس الموقع. ومن هذا تسبقها مع ذلك انه يشير الى الفيلم الحالي كليب. عندما ينقر مستخدم في اي مكان ، onclipevent (mouseup (عمال فى جميع الفيلم لقطات احصل اثارت. بعد ذلك ، سواء من الفيلم لقطات اداء hittest اختبار ؛ واحد فقط هو ان الفأر تحت الاختبار ايجابية وسوف نقفز الى الاطار (2).

اختيار النصي

لتغيير هذا الاختيار الى النصي ، ونحن لا بد ان يسمح للمستخدم أن ينقر الفيلم كليب عدة مرات وتغيير حالة الفيلم من كليب من لعن وعوده الى الفرار مرة اخرى.

وقد يكون النص لتحديد الدولة التي الفيلم كليب حاليا في وثم ارسل الي قصاصة أخرى الاطار. السكريبت يمكن تحديد الحاله الراهنة من خلال النظر الى الاطار الحالي للفيلم كليب. ويمكن ان يتم ذلك مع بجدارة اسمه _currentframe الممتلكات. هذه الممتلكات (1) عندما يقرأ فيلم كليب هو الاول على الإطار 2 وعندما يكون على الثانية.

الجديد هنا هو الكتابة. هذا امر معقد النصي لأنها أول التجارب موقع الفار وثم التجارب الحالية في اطار الفيلم كليب.

  Onclipevent (mouseup) (اذا (this.hittest (_root._xmouse ، _root._ymouse)) (اذا (this._currentframe == 1) (this.gotoandstop (2) ؛) آخر (this.gotoandstop) 1) ؛))) 

الآن رأيتم اثنان مختلفة تماما السبل الكفيلة بجعل اختيارها لقطات الفيلم. أحب الطريقة الثانية افضل لأنك لا ينتهي مع رموز من خارج المكتبه من الأزرار. ميزة استخدام ازرار ، ومع ذلك ، هو انها يمكن ان تحتوي على ما يصل بسهولة ، اسفل ، واكثر من الدول ، التي تكون أحيانا لطيفة لمعرفة رأي المستفيدين من كمستعملين خياراتها

هذا هو مقال اضافها باولو caldeira

Share  

© 2005-2010 E-articles.info All Rights Reserved - Terms and conditions